Caine does not appear
Prerequisite check
- Confirm two distinct players are present, one is already Abstracted, and the nearby player remains normal.
Caine does not appear
Check first
- Confirm one player is already Abstracted and the other remains normal.
- Keep the normal player nearby and confirm that the demonstrated chat input can be entered.
- Do not add an action that is absent from the July 11 visual sources.
Likely causes
- The two July 11 observed roles or the Abstracted prerequisite may not be in place.Unconfirmed
- The nearby normal player may not have completed the demonstrated Caine chat action.Unconfirmed
- Account chat restrictions are reported to prevent the demonstrated input.Reported
Unknowns
- No no-chat alternative is verified by the available evidence.
- The evidence does not establish a spawn probability or wait time.
Interpret the result
- A missing role or chat input means the dated prerequisite was not reproduced.
- If roles and input match but Caine is absent, record a dated mismatch.

What to Record
Record the symptom, condition, roles, chat, and visible result. Add UTC time and live-build state. For scene mismatches, note a stable landmark, not a guessed coordinate. Exclude account IDs and private chat.
FAQ
Why is Caine not appearing?
Use the Caine checks for role, chat, build, and result.
Why is the Cellar sequence not starting?
Use the Cellar checks after Caine; no extra input is verified.
How long should I wait for a trigger?
Unknown. No exact activation timer is published. Confirm the prerequisite and visible result instead of inventing a countdown.
Will rejoining fix an older server?
No guarantee; another server is only a comparison.
Does unchanged Sanity mean the player is safe?
Not by itself. Reverse one published risk condition and compare the same player's visible state. Exact rates and thresholds remain Unknown.
I followed a YouTube clip and it still fails—what now?
Clips lag behind patches. Check Updates for Needs Recheck, re-read the matching guide for the dated success signal, then run the symptom section that matches what you actually see—not the video title.
Can chat restrictions block Caine?
Yes—if chat is unavailable, the dated Caine summon path cannot run. Open the chat unavailable checks before blaming the Cellar.
